Analysis

The most recent figure for renewable natural capital, mangroves in Togo is 57.57 million current US$, measured in 2020. That is the highest value across all 26 years on record.

The figure is up 21.3% on the previous year and up 288.5% over five years.

Over the whole period, renewable natural capital, mangroves in Togo peaked at 57.57 million current US$ in 2020 and was at its lowest, 0 current US$, in 1995.

That places Togo 58th out of 150 countries with data for 2020, putting it in the middle of the range.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.
